Typical Therapy Strategies and Referrals



Chiropractic therapy strategies usually involve a collection of check outs customized to your particular demands. Initially, you could see your chiropractic physician two to three times a week, especially if you're taking care of acute pain.

As your condition improves, the frequency generally reduces to once a week or biweekly. Your chiropractic doctor will examine your progression and change your check outs accordingly.

In addition to back modifications, your plan might consist of exercises, way of life recommendations, and dietary suggestions to enhance your healing.
